发明名称 |
News production system with dynamic media server allocation |
摘要 |
An example method involves: (i) accessing data representing a news program schedule that specifies a sequence of events to be carried out using a news production system, wherein the schedule is divided into contiguous portions; (ii) for each portion: determining that m media servers are sufficient to execute any events of that portion and associated with a first device, allocating m media servers to the first device, thereby leaving one or more unallocated media servers, and allocating n media servers, from the unallocated media servers, to a second device; and (iii) for each of the contiguous portions, utilizing at least a portion of the allocated m media servers to carry out the events specified in that portion and associated with the first device and utilizing at least a portion of the allocated n media servers to carry out the events specified in that portion and associated with the second device. |
申请公布号 |
US9554173(B1) |
申请公布日期 |
2017.01.24 |
申请号 |
US201614996963 |
申请日期 |
2016.01.15 |
申请人 |
Tribune Broadcasting Company, LLC |
发明人 |
Hundemer Hank J. |
分类号 |
H04N7/16;H04N21/262;H04N21/2665;H04N21/2343;H04N21/845;H04N21/81;H04N21/231;G06F9/50;H04L29/06 |
主分类号 |
H04N7/16 |
代理机构 |
McDonnell Boehnen Hulbert & Berghoff LLP |
代理人 |
McDonnell Boehnen Hulbert & Berghoff LLP |
主权项 |
1. A method for use with a system comprising multiple media servers, a router, a first destination device, and a second destination device, wherein an output of each of the media servers is connected to a respective input of the router, a first output of the router is connected to an input of the first destination device, and a second output of the router is connected to an input of the second destination device, the method comprising:
accessing data representing a program schedule that specifies a sequence of events to be carried out using the system, wherein the program schedule is divided into contiguous portions; for each of the contiguous portions: (i) determining that m media servers are sufficient to execute any events that are of that portion and that are associated with the first destination device, (ii) allocating m media servers to the first destination device, thereby leaving one or more unallocated media servers, and (iii) allocating n media servers, from among the one or more unallocated media servers, to the second destination device; and for each of the contiguous portions (i) utilizing at least a portion of the allocated m media servers to carry out the events that are specified in that portion and that are associated with the first destination device, and (ii) utilizing at least a portion of the allocated n media servers to carry out the events that are specified in that portion and that are associated with the second destination device. |
地址 |
Chicago IL US |